What Are No-Code Platforms?

No-code platforms are tools that allow users to build applications, websites, and software solutions without writing any code. These platforms provide intuitive, drag-and-drop interfaces, pre-built templates, and a range of customization options, enabling users to create functional and visually appealing projects quickly and efficiently.

Key Features of No-Code Platforms

1. Drag-and-Drop Interface

No-code platforms typically feature a visual editor where users can drag and drop elements to build their applications. This user-friendly interface simplifies the development process and makes it accessible to non-programmers.

2. Pre-Built Templates and Components

These platforms offer a variety of templates and pre-built components that users can customize to suit their needs. This feature accelerates the development process and ensures that even beginners can create professional-looking applications.

3. Integration Capabilities

No-code platforms often provide seamless integration with other tools and services, such as databases, APIs, and third-party applications. This allows users to enhance their projects with additional functionalities.

4. Customization Options

While no-code platforms are designed to be simple, they also offer advanced customization options for users who want to add unique features or tailor their applications to specific requirements.

Benefits for Students

1. Accessibility

No-code platforms democratize software development, making it accessible to students from all backgrounds. Whether you’re studying computer science, business, design, or any other field, you can use no-code tools to bring your ideas to life.

2. Rapid Prototyping

For students working on projects or startups, no-code platforms enable rapid prototyping. You can quickly create MVPs (Minimum Viable Products) to test your ideas, gather feedback, and iterate on your designs.

3. Focus on Creativity and Innovation

By removing the complexities of coding, no-code platforms allow students to focus on creativity and innovation. You can experiment with different designs, functionalities, and user experiences without getting bogged down by technical details.

4. Cost-Effective

No-code platforms often offer free or affordable plans, making them a cost-effective solution for students. You can build and launch applications without the need for expensive software or hiring developers.

5. Skill Enhancement

Using no-code platforms helps students develop valuable skills, such as problem-solving, project management, and user experience design. These skills are highly transferable and beneficial in various career paths.

Popular No-Code Platforms

1. Webflow

Webflow is a powerful no-code platform for building responsive websites. It offers a visual editor, CMS capabilities, and integration with various tools, making it ideal for web designers and developers.

2. Bubble

Bubble allows users to create complex web applications with a visual interface. It supports dynamic content, database management, and API integrations, making it suitable for building interactive apps and SaaS products.

3. Airtable

Airtable combines the functionalities of a spreadsheet and a database, enabling users to create custom applications for project management, CRM, and more. Its flexibility and ease of use make it popular among students and professionals alike.

4. Glide

Glide is a no-code platform for building mobile apps from Google Sheets. It’s perfect for creating simple, data-driven mobile applications without any coding knowledge.

5. Zapier

Zapier connects different apps and automates workflows without coding. It’s useful for students who want to streamline their tasks and integrate various tools and services.

Challenges and Considerations

1. Limitations in Customization

While no-code platforms offer a high degree of flexibility, they may not support highly complex or unique functionalities that require custom coding.

2. Scalability Concerns

For large-scale applications, no-code platforms might face scalability issues. Students should evaluate whether the platform can handle their project’s growth and complexity.

3. Learning Curve

Although easier than traditional coding, no-code platforms still require time and effort to learn. Students should be prepared to invest some time in mastering the platform’s features and capabilities.
